Pension refund is usually relevant for people who paid into the German pension system, may not fit the standard pension path and want to check whether reclaiming contributions makes more sense than waiting for regular retirement benefits.

Voluntary contributions can make sense when you are comparing a longer-term pension-building route against refund or another pension option. The answer depends on contribution history, residence and the broader pension goal, so it should always be weighed in context first.

Sometimes yes, especially when a refund is less realistic and a longer-term pension route deserves more attention. The right answer still depends on contribution history, current residence and the broader pension plan, so it should be checked before you commit to one path.
